Abstract

A pressure relief system is provided and a corresponding method for relieving pressure from a duct routing a gas from a compressor to a load utilizing the same. According to one aspect, a pressure relief assembly, located near the load, and independent of the primary load compressor pressure relief valve, for use with a duct includes a cover, first and second chambers, and a piston. The piston provides a moveable wall between the chambers and is coupled to the cover. As gas from the duct enters the two chambers, the configuration of the chambers provides for a pressure differential that moves the piston and the corresponding cover. This movement transitions the cover from a closed configuration that seals the duct to an open configuration that allows gas within the duct to escape.
